A IA generativa (Gen AI) está mudando o cenário da inteligência artificial, abrindo novas oportunidades para criatividade, resolução de problemas e automação. Apesar do seu potencial, surgem vários desafios para desenvolvedores e empresas ao implementar soluções Gen AI. Um dos problemas mais proeminentes é a falta de interoperabilidade entre modelos de linguagem em larga escala (LLMs) de vários fornecedores. Cada modelo possui APIs, configurações e requisitos exclusivos, tornando difícil para os desenvolvedores alternar entre provedores ou usar modelos diferentes no mesmo aplicativo. Esse mundo díspar geralmente leva ao aumento da complexidade, ao aumento do tempo de desenvolvimento e aos desafios para os desenvolvedores que desejam criar aplicativos Gen AI eficazes.
A equipe de Andrew Ng lançou uma nova biblioteca Python de código aberto para Gen AI chamada não é uma suíte. Esta biblioteca visa resolver o problema de interoperabilidade e simplificar o processo de construção de aplicações que utilizam exemplos de grandes linguagens de diferentes provedores. Com o aisuite, os desenvolvedores podem alternar entre modelos de OpenAI, Anthropic, Ollama e outros alterando uma única string em seu código. A biblioteca apresenta uma interface padrão que permite aos usuários selecionar uma combinação “provedor:modelo”, como “openai:gpt-4o,” “anthropic:claude-3-5-sonnet-20241022,” ou “ollama:llama3.1 :8b”, que permite alternar facilmente entre diferentes modelos de linguagem sem a necessidade de reescrever partes importantes do código.
Detalhes técnicos
Do ponto de vista técnico, o aisuite fornece uma interface simples para gerenciar vários LLMs, tornando-o uma ferramenta útil para desenvolvedores. Ao remover as complexidades associadas a múltiplas APIs, fornece uma estrutura unificada que lida com diferentes tipos de solicitações e respostas. Os desenvolvedores podem usar o aisuite para integrar vários modelos em seus aplicativos com apenas algumas linhas de código. Isso resulta em barreiras de entrada mais baixas para projetos Gen AI, prototipagem e implantação mais rápidas. Outro recurso importante é sua extensibilidade: o aisuite permite que os desenvolvedores adicionem novos modelos e provedores à medida que chegam ao mercado, garantindo que os aplicativos possam ficar atualizados com os mais recentes recursos de IA.
A importância do aisuite reside na sua capacidade de simplificar o processo de desenvolvimento, economizar tempo e reduzir custos. Para equipes que precisam de flexibilidade, a capacidade do aisuite de alternar entre modelos com base em tarefas e requisitos específicos fornece uma ferramenta valiosa para melhorar o desempenho. Por exemplo, os desenvolvedores podem usar o GPT-4 da OpenAI para criar conteúdo criativo, mas mudar para um modelo especial da Antrópico para obter resultados realistas e atrasados. Os primeiros benchmarks e o feedback da comunidade mostram que o uso do aisuite pode reduzir o tempo de integração de aplicativos multimodelos, destacando seu impacto na melhoria da eficiência e produtividade do desenvolvedor.
A conclusão
Aisuite representa um desenvolvimento lógico para a comunidade Gen AI, simplificando a complexidade envolvida no uso de grandes modelos de linguagem de diferentes fornecedores. Ao fornecer uma interface unificada, a equipe de Andrew Ng reduziu as barreiras à integração de recursos avançados de IA em aplicativos, facilitando a experimentação e a construção dos desenvolvedores. À medida que o ecossistema Gen AI continua a crescer, ferramentas como o aisuite desempenharão um papel importante na promoção da acessibilidade e da adoção, permitindo que mais pessoas e organizações aproveitem o poder da IA sem serem limitadas pelas barreiras técnicas associadas à integração de modelos.
Confira eu Página GitHub. Todo o crédito deste estudo vai para os pesquisadores deste projeto. Além disso, não se esqueça de nos seguir Twitter e junte-se ao nosso Estação telefônica de novo LinkedIn Gracima. Se você gosta do nosso trabalho, você vai gostar do nosso jornal.. Não se esqueça de participar do nosso SubReddit de 55k + ML.
🎙️ 🚨 'Avaliação de vulnerabilidade de um modelo de linguagem grande: uma análise comparativa de técnicas de clustering vermelho' Leia o relatório completo (Promovido)
Asif Razzaq é o CEO da Marktechpost Media Inc. Como empresário e engenheiro visionário, Asif está empenhado em aproveitar o poder da Inteligência Artificial em benefício da sociedade. Seu mais recente empreendimento é o lançamento da Plataforma de Mídia de Inteligência Artificial, Marktechpost, que se destaca por sua ampla cobertura de histórias de aprendizado de máquina e aprendizado profundo que parecem tecnicamente sólidas e facilmente compreendidas por um amplo público. A plataforma possui mais de 2 milhões de visualizações mensais, o que mostra sua popularidade entre o público.
🧵🧵 [Download] Avaliação do relatório do modelo de risco linguístico principal (ampliado)